Default How Do You Pick Your Horses / Dogs?

I just finished reading through a site dedicated to approaches to picking horses and betting. There was some good practical advice. A key point being to learn from races where you don't pick a horse in the finish eg what did you miss in your assessment and build it into to your method.

It started me thinking 'how different people arrive at their picks'. Love to start a discussion to understand the different approaches we use.
